Lagos resident stabs friend with jack-knife over misunderstanding
A 37-year-old man, Bababunmi Ositelu, on Friday appeared before an Ogudu Magistrates’ Court, Lagos State, for allegedly stabbing his friend on the neck.
Ositelu, whose residential address was not provided, is standing trial on four charges of causing grievous harm, wilful damage, breach of peace and unlawful display of arm.
He, however, pleaded not guilty.
The prosecutor, Insp Donjour Perezi, told the court that the defendant committed the offences on March 19 on Aina Street, Ojota, Lagos State.
He said that the defendant stabbed his friend, Mr. Bello Abideen, with a jack-knife following a misunderstanding.
Perezi added that the defendant wilfully damaged a pair of blue trousers worth $200 (N108,000) which Abideen was wearing.
“The defendant conducted himself in a manner likely to cause breach of peace by blocking Aina Street with his Toyota Prado and displaying a dangerous weapon,” he said.
He submitted that the Abideen was still receiving treatment in a hospital.
The prosecutor said that the offences contravened Sections, 51, 168, 245 and ,350 of the Criminal Law of Lagos State, 2015.
The Magistrate, Mrs O.M. Ajayi granted the defendant bail in the sum of N250, 000 with two sureties in like sum.
She ordered that the sureties must provide proof of tax payment to Lagos State Government.
She adjourned the case until April 27 for mention.
